Yes. In contrast, Murray Halberg and Ron Clarke were some 800m forces with 1:51 speed. This speed enabled Halberg to finish 5ks ss fast as the best today.
Halberg's best distances were the 2 mile/5k. Because he wasn't as fast as contemporaries like Elliott and Snell, the mile wasn't his best distance. In that regard he was similar to Ingebrigtsen, in that endurance was his greatest strength - and so it was for Clarke, although he had less speed than Halberg and no finishing kick, unlike Halberg. In fact Halberg probably had a better kick relative to his competition than Ingebrigtsen does.
Halberg's training was: 100 mpw of continous runs at easy to moderate speed for 3+ months. Then 2 months of "Hill bounding" 5 days per week, long run and easy run on other 2 days. Then short track speed sessions, easy runs and racing for 2-4 months.
Compared to today's top runners training the Lydiard program was much easier (except for the 100 mpw block).
